Flood Advisory issued May 8 at 9:50PM CDT until May 29 at 1:00AM CDT by NWS Jackson MS

…The Flood Advisory is extended for the following rivers in
Louisiana…Mississippi…Arkansas…

Mississippi River Near Greenville affecting Washington, East
Carroll, Issaquena and Chicot Counties.

* WHAT…Flooding caused by excessive rainfall continues.

* WHERE…Mississippi River near Greenville.

* WHEN…Until Thursday, May 29.

* IMPACTS…At 44.5 feet, Road to Bunge Corporation grain elevators
is under water.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S…
– At 9:00 AM CDT Thursday the stage was 44.8 feet.
– Forecast…The river is expected to fall to 32.0 feet
Thursday, June 05.
– Action stage is 36.0 feet.
– Flood stage is 48.0 feet.
